Overview of ChatGPT’s Operator Agent
ChatGPT’s Operator is an advanced AI-driven automation agent designed to assist users by handling various web-based tasks autonomously. Powered by the sophisticated GPT-4o model, the Operator seamlessly integrates natural language processing capabilities with automated interaction features, enabling it to execute complex user commands efficiently. By leveraging this tool, users can offload repetitive and time-consuming online activities, making everyday tasks simpler and faster.
Whether booking a table at a restaurant, purchasing event tickets, managing online shopping carts, or filling out lengthy forms, the Operator streamlines processes that typically require manual effort. This saves time and reduces user fatigue associated with navigating complex or tedious web interfaces.
Key Features of ChatGPT’s Operator
- Web Navigation
- The Operator mimics human-like web browsing behaviour, allowing it to navigate websites intuitively. It can load pages, follow links, and dynamically adapt to website layouts, even in pop-ups or unexpected page structures. This adaptability ensures that the Operator performs efficiently across a variety of platforms.
- Automated Interaction
- With the ability to interact directly with web elements, the Operator can perform essential tasks such as clicking buttons, selecting checkboxes, scrolling through content, and entering text into fields. It recognizes and responds to graphical or textual cues on websites, ensuring precise command execution.
- User Autonomy and Control
- To prioritize user security and privacy, the Operator requests confirmation for sensitive actions, such as handling payments, submitting private information, or logging into accounts. This ensures users maintain control over critical processes while benefiting from automation.
- Task Customization and Versatility
- Users can tailor the Operator’s functionality to suit specific needs. Whether defining particular search parameters, automating bulk data entry, or scheduling tasks, the Operator adapts to varied requirements, making it a versatile tool for personal and professional use.
- Contextual Understanding
- Leveraging GPT-4o’s contextual reasoning power, the Operator can interpret ambiguous user instructions and clarify details when needed. For example, when asked to “find a nearby Italian restaurant and make a reservation for two,” it not only searches for restaurants but also seamlessly handles the reservation process.

4. User Eligibility
Access to the ChatGPT Operator is limited to ensure a controlled and focused release. This initial phase allows OpenAI to gather valuable user feedback and refine the system for broader use. Below are the specific eligibility criteria and plans for future availability:
Current Eligibility
- Subscription Requirement: The Operator is exclusively available to ChatGPT Pro subscribers, granting early adopters access to advanced automation features.
- Geographic Availability: For now, the service is primarily restricted to users in the United States, reflecting OpenAI’s cautious rollout strategy to ensure compliance with local laws and regulations.
- Age Restriction: Only individuals aged 18 and older can access the Operator, ensuring that users possess the legal capacity to engage in activities such as online purchases and agreements.
Planned Expansions
OpenAI is actively working to extend the Operator’s reach and usability shortly, with several key developments expected:
- Additional Subscription Tiers: Access is anticipated to expand beyond ChatGPT Pro to include users on the Plus, Team, and Enterprise plans. This will allow businesses and collaborative teams to benefit from its automation capabilities.
- International Availability: Broader access is planned for users outside the U.S. While timelines remain flexible, regions with stringent data protection laws, such as the European Union, may experience delays due to regulatory reviews and compliance adaptations.
- Localized Support: Future rollouts should include localization features, enabling the Operator to handle tasks in multiple languages and adjust to region-specific preferences or requirements.

5. Limitations and Challenges
Despite its advanced capabilities, ChatGPT’s Operator is not without its constraints. These limitations reflect the current developmental phase of the tool and highlight areas where future improvements are necessary. Below is a breakdown of the key challenges:
5.1 Complex Task Navigation
- Limitations with Intricate Workflows: The Operator may face challenges in navigating tasks that require advanced contextual reasoning, such as coordinating multi-step calendar management or integrating multiple services in a single operation.
- Complex Interfaces: Websites with overly intricate layouts, heavy graphical content, or non-standard components (e.g., custom-built frameworks or dynamic elements) can disrupt the Operator’s ability to interact effectively. This can result in errors or incomplete task execution.
5.2 User Oversight Required
- Sensitive Interactions: While automation is the Operator’s core strength, specific tasks—such as entering sensitive financial information or confirming significant transactions—still require user involvement. This precautionary measure is essential to safeguard privacy and maintain trust but limits the full potential of automation.
- Error Mitigation: The Operator may occasionally misinterpret ambiguous instructions or incorrectly interact with website elements, necessitating user intervention to correct or clarify tasks.
5.3 Rate and Usage Limits
- Dynamic Constraints: The Operator operates within predefined rate limits to prevent overuse and ensure fair resource allocation. These limits reset daily, balancing performance across the user base but potentially restricting heavy usage.
- Scalability Challenges: High-demand scenarios, such as a sudden influx of tasks during peak hours, may result in temporary slowdowns or reduced responsiveness.
5.4 Evolution Still in Progress
- Reliability Across Diverse Scenarios: As a research preview, the Operator’s capabilities are not yet fully optimized for universal compatibility. While it excels in many areas, its performance may vary depending on the complexity or uniqueness of specific tasks.
- Dependence on Feedback: Continuous user feedback is vital for identifying issues, refining features, and improving the tool’s reliability. Its success hinges on iterative development and collaboration between users and developers.

6.3 “Take Over Mode”
- User Intervention on Sensitive Tasks: The Operator automatically pauses when sensitive actions are encountered, such as filling out payment forms, entering login credentials, or interacting with personal documents. In this “Take Over Mode,” users can manually complete the task to ensure accuracy and security.
- Seamless Transition: Once the sensitive task is completed, users can seamlessly resume automation, balancing convenience and control.
